Sunstroke (中暑) is a condition that can quickly go from dangerous to deadly,especially if proper care isn't given immediately.
Sunstroke,sometimes called heatstroke,is a result of the body temperature rising above the safe limit. This causes the body's necessary functions to stop working.
It's usually pretty easy to avoid sunstroke,as long as proper action is taken. In that case,you need to act as quickly as possible to return that person's body to a safe temperature. Here are a few tips to help treat sunstroke.
Call for help
Call to get an ambulance as quickly as possible. This should be the first thing you do,especially if the sunstroke person has fainted (昏倒). Also,call for help from anyone nearby if you're in a public place. If there's no one around,call someone nearby if they can get there sooner than an ambulance. Ask everyone to bring you as much water as possible,if there isn't much nearby.
Get the person to a cooler area
If there's a building nearby,aim for that. Anywhere with plenty of air conditioners and water is perfect. If a building isn't available,bring the person to a well-shaded area.
Get the water flowing
If the person is still conscious,get him or her to drink water. If there's a bathtub available,fill it with cool water and put the person in it.
If your water supply is limited,you have to save it. Dampen a towel or shirt and put it on the person's body. Focus on the face,neck,and chest.
Fan the person
Getting moving air over the person cools him or her down. Use anything,a towel or sheet,a shirt,your hands,or a piece of board. This is where having many people around really helps,as they can combine to fan the entire body.
